Why Set Up Your Google Business Profile

Your Google Business Profile is your digital storefront, and it’s essential for attracting customers. Here’s why you should prioritize creating one:

  • Increased visibility in local searches: A well-optimized profile ensures that your business appears when potential customers search for services in Pinellas Park. This is particularly important in a community with local favorites like the Pinellas Park Performing Arts Center, where many people look for nearby dining and shopping options.
  • Access to valuable insights about customer interactions: Gain insights into how customers find you and what actions they take on your profile. This data is invaluable for refining your marketing strategy and understanding customer preferences.
  • Ability to manage online reviews and customer feedback: Engaging with reviews—both positive and negative—allows you to build trust with your audience. Responding to feedback shows that you care about your customers’ experiences, which can lead to increased loyalty.
  • Enhanced connection with your audience through posts and updates: Use your profile to share news, promotions, or events directly with your audience. This keeps your business top-of-mind for locals who appreciate staying informed about their favorite spots.

How to Set Up Your Google Business Profile

Setting up your Google Business Profile is simpler than you might think. Follow these steps to get started and ensure you’re visible to potential customers:

  • Visit the Google Business Profile website: Go to the Google Business Profile page and sign in with your Google account. If you don’t have one, creating a Google account is a straightforward process.
  • Enter your business name and address: Be precise when entering your business details. Choosing the correct business category helps Google to match you with relevant searches.
  • Fill out your profile with accurate information: Include your business hours, phone number, and website link. Take the time to ensure that all information is correct and up-to-date, as this builds trust with your potential customers.
  • Verify your business: This usually involves receiving a postcard from Google at your listed address, which contains a verification code. This step is essential for ensuring that your business is legitimate.
  • Add photos and a description: Showcase your business by adding high-quality images and a compelling description. Highlight what makes your business unique—whether it’s your cozy atmosphere, exceptional service, or delicious menu items. Photos can include the interior of your shop, your team, and even customer interactions to give potential customers a feel for your brand.
